ATJ 2103.3 - APPELLANT'S BRIEF. This form is used by an appellant—the party appealing a trial court decision—to prepare and file an Appellant’s Brief in the Illinois Appellate Court. It is approved by the Illinois Supreme Court and must be accepted by the appellate court. The form guides appellants through the process of organizing and presenting their legal arguments, including identifying the nature of the case, listing the legal issues for review, stating the court’s jurisdiction, and laying out a detailed argument supported by legal authorities and facts from the trial court record. It requires information about the trial court proceedings, including the case history, judgment details, post-judgment motions, and timelines for appeal. The brief must comply with formatting, length, and structure requirements outlined in Illinois Supreme Court Rule 341. The form also includes sections for the table of contents, points and authorities, statements of jurisdiction and facts, argument sections for up to three issues, a conclusion stating the relief sought, a certificate of compliance, and a proof of delivery.
